Kinds Of Replacement Window Locks

When checking out replacement window locks, it's essential to consider various designs to discover the best suitable for your requirements. Below is a table describing the most common kinds of window locks.

Kind of LockDescriptionBest ForSash LockUtilized on double-hung windows, protecting the sashes.Conventional windowsSliding LockSpecifically developed for sliding windows.Sliding glass doorsCasement LockOperates with a handle that secures the window.Casement windowsKeyed LockNeeds a key for operation, supplying included security.High-security requirementsWindow LatchSimple mechanism that keeps the window from opening.Fundamental securityPin LockA pin is placed into the window frame.Easy-to-install alternatives

Selecting the Right Lock

When picking a replacement window lock, think about the list below elements:

  • Window Type: Ensure the lock is compatible with your window style.
  • Security Level: Higher security needs may call for keyed locks or additional functions.
  • Product: Choose durable products like stainless-steel or brass.
  • Relieve of Installation: Some locks may need professional installation, while others can be DIY tasks.
Kinds Of Replacement Window Handles

Window handles are simply as important as locks. They can be found in different designs and products, each offering special advantages. Below is a table showcasing the typical types of window handles.

Kind of HandleDescriptionBest ForCrank HandleUsed with casement windows, cranks open and closes.Casement windowsPush/Pull HandleSimple design for sliding and double-hung windows.User friendly alternativesDiecast HandleRobust with different finishes, providing security.Heavy-duty applicationsRaise HandlePermits for simpler lifting of sliding windows.Sliding windowsLocking HandleIntegrates a handle and lock for security.Additional security requires

Picking the Right Handle

When choosing a replacement handle, think about the following aspects:

  • Compatibility: Ensure the handle fits your window design.
  • Product and Finish: Opt for surfaces that complement your home's design.
  • Functionality: Choose practical handles that deal ease of operation.
Setup Tips for Window Locks and Handles

Setting up replacement locks and handles can be uncomplicated, but it's important to follow proper standards to ensure efficiency and safety. Here are some tips:

  1. Gather Tools: Common tools consist of a screwdriver, drill, level, and measuring tape.

  2. Read Instructions: Always follow the manufacturer's guidelines for specific setup steps.

  3. Remove Old Hardware: Carefully separate any existing locks or handles without damaging the window frame.

  4. Set Up New Hardware: Position the new lock/handle according to the guidelines, using a level to ensure it is straight.

  5. Test Functionality: After setup, operate the window to guarantee everything works efficiently.

Maintenance of Window Locks and Handles

Regular upkeep can prolong the lifespan of window locks and handles. Here are some upkeep pointers:

  1. Check for Wear: Regularly examine locks and handles for signs of wear or damage.

  2. Lube Moving Parts: Use a silicone-based lubricant to keep locks and handles running smoothly.

  3. Clean: Clean locks and handles with a damp cloth to eliminate dirt and gunk.

  4. Tighten Up Loose Screws: Regularly examine screws and bolts to ensure a secure fit.

  5. Change When Necessary: If locks or handles show significant wear or failure, replace them immediately to keep your windows secure.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How do I know if I require to change my window locks or handles?

If you notice difficulty in opening or securing your windows, or if the locks show visible wear or rust, it may be time for a replacement.

2. Can I install replacement locks and handles myself?

3. What materials are best for window locks and handles?

Stainless-steel and brass are popular due to their resilience and resistance to rust and deterioration.

4. How often should I keep my window locks and handles?

It's sensible to perform upkeep checks a minimum of two times a year or whenever you alter the seasons.

5. What if my window is an unusual size or design?

Custom locks and handles are available for special window styles. Remember to determine before purchasing to guarantee an appropriate fit.
